What do you wish you'd bought BEFORE moving to NZ?
 
Hi all,

Our stuff is getting packed up the end of January and I'm starting to make a list of the things I really want to buy here in the UK before heading over to NZ. Top of my list is a Dyson vacuum cleaner, as it looks like they are stupidly expensive over in NZ (some close to $1,000!!). I am also taking about 2 years' supply of my Benefit foundation make-up, as I pay £17 for it here via an eBay shop, don't even know if it's available in NZ, but in Sydney department stores, it is AUD$65!!!

Is there anything you wish you had known about that is either unavailable or outrageously expensive in NZ that you now wished you'd bought before leaving the UK??

Jan n Neil Nov 18th 2011 5:58 pm

Re: What do you wish you'd bought BEFORE moving to NZ?
 
Use the hoover :rofl: then it won't look new :thumbsup:

Coustoms don't crawl all over your container. They look at the list, probably to make sure you're not a dealer in something, see it's emigration, and pass it to MAF to look for dirty things. Your Hoover however will be fine - wipe it down, make it look used-but-clean, no problem.

Jan

sarahinnz Nov 19th 2011 9:23 pm

Re: What do you wish you'd bought BEFORE moving to NZ?
 
Hi
we moved here 6yrs ago and within the first 6 few months we wished we had bought EVERYTHING with us. Electrical stuff is expensive especially if you want the brand quality your used to in the UK. I recommend if its cleanable and you can ship it, then bring it with you especially with the exchange rate at the moment. It cost us so much more than we thought to set up a house again. We had friends who moved out 3 months after us and they had no trouble bringing everything out from the garden lawn mower (as long as its cleaned first) to their flat screen TV.

Hope this helps:thumbsup:

yorkylass Nov 20th 2011 12:07 am

Re: What do you wish you'd bought BEFORE moving to NZ?
 
we bought loads of new stuff with us, just take it out of the boxes / packaging. We bought a new dyson, kettle, toaster, microwave and loads of bedding. Wish I'd bought more bedding though, you cant beat M and S or Next, they wash great unlike a lot of stuff you buy here !!!

Make up is rediculously expensive here, so stock up on mascara, lippy and your favourite facecream too.

Dont buy TVs - they are so cheap here.

Good luck with the move. We love our new life here :sunglasses:

TOOLS TOOLS TOOLS! cheap tools here fall apart, poor quality. you end up paying over the odds for good tools which are cheap in UK THEY HAVE TO BE CLEAN!

BOOKS BOOKS BOOKS if you like reading - books. although you can get most things via amazon.com for kindles.

GOOD QUALITY CLOTHES tend to be expensive here. the cheap stuff is made in china and poor quality and still much more expensive than cheap stuff in UK. (ie 5GBP shorts are $30NZD)
dont bother bringing woollen stuff - lots here!

GOOD SHOES oh yes, if you like good quality shoes, bring shoes.

if you like old stuff, you can get great old antique-ish furniture here at auction.
electrical and white goods are cheap here

have a look on the NZ shopping chain websites MITRE 10, FARMERS, WHITCOULLS, BUNNINGS, BODYSHOP etc

look at www.oilyrag.co.nz to see what people are finding expensive in NZ
